It seems clear now that im-cedilla was merely a hack
to workaround the lack of X compose support in gtk-im-context-simple,
which is provided through im-xim.so. Using im-xim.so
should give us consistent keyboard input for all locales
across X, GTK, and Qt applications which is a big usability plus
for users dependent on X compose for writing their language.
I can only repeat my position on this:
We need a single input method framework and we need to tighly integrate it with
keyboard layout configuration and the rest of the desktop. Tagging input method
support onto desktops 'from the side' and trying to make it both
'desktop-neutral' and 'im-framework-neutral' is always going to provide
an
insufficient user experience.
